Position Overview
Stanley is looking for a highly skilled and ambitious individual to join our information technology team as an Oracle Finance Implementation Architect. In this role, you will have the opportunity to collaborate with finance partners to implement effective business improvements. Your responsibilities will include working with Oracle ERP modules such as General Ledger, Accounts Payable, Accounts Receivable, Inventory Costing, Subledger Accounting, and Cash Management. You will also provide exceptional support for the Oracle ERP system and serve as the technical lead for Finance applications, working closely with finance experts to assess system capabilities and implement effective strategies.
What You'll Do
- Own system implementation and technical design for Oracle ERP core Finance modules.
- Lead/drive Order to Cash, Procure to Pay, and Financials related technical design, development, and support.
- Configure and test Oracle ERP Finance processes: AR, AP, GL, SLA, Cash Management, etc.
- Develop and implement test plans to check infrastructure and systems technical development, and make recommendations for improvement.
- Design and support integrations with other cloud-based finance applications, such as Incentive Compensation and EPM.
- Provide advanced technical applications expertise and design and development guidance to technical developers on integrations/RICE components.
- Develop queries and reports to meet end-user requirements and facilitate analysis, conduct root cause analysis, and address Oracle production challenges.

Education and Experience
- Bachelor's degree in computer science, management information systems, or a closely related field.
- 5 years of demonstrated ability in a technical role implementing and supporting Oracle EBS R12 finance modules, including GL, AP, SLA, Cash Management, etc.
- Data conversion experience from Oracle EBS to Oracle EBS or legacy system to Oracle EBS.
- Designing, mapping, and developing integrations between Oracle EBS and other finance applications.
- Experience with RICEW identification, technical design, development, and leading developers through the development cycle.
- Ability to perform SQL queries and have knowledge of backend table structures.
- Working knowledge of custom objects in Oracle Environment, including forms, reports, workflows, etc.
- Thorough understanding of Finance processes and experience with documenting business requirements, participating in fit-gap analysis, technical development lifecycle, leading testing, and deployment of Oracle Finance solutions.
- Experience with Oracle EPM and Incentive Compensation is a plus.
- Proficient in a range of Oracle EBS R12 implementations, Roll Outs, Post-implementation support with AIM methodologies.
